Why do you get different results in your Sun system? Which one is flawed?

Probably because one of them uses the x87 fpu and the other uses a proper implementation of IEEE754. x87 uses registers wider than standard floating-point precision, which can lead to more exact results (most stupid idea Intel ever had), however this is unpredictable and unreproducible on other floating point units, or even on other x87s running the same code compiled differently, or if the fpu itself is configured differently on different runs. Or perhaps if the phase of the moon differs. With x87 you never really know what result you're getting. This makes it incredibly hard (when not outright impossible) to make portable floating-point based simulations, unless you can avoid x87 altogether (which is no trivial task in itself).

Reproducitibility of floating point calculations is a hairy topic, and it's largely because of x87.

Floating-point math is a standard (IEEE754) and in theory all implementations should give the same results. In practice it's really freakin' hard to make arbitrary C/C++ floating point code be coherent across different platforms, compilers, and even sometimes the same compiler on the same machine. Intel and AMD implement IEEE754 in two different instruction sets, x87 and SSE. Both were originally designed by Intel; SSE is consistent and x87 isn't.

There could be other causes behind the inconsistency seen here. Floating-point arithmetic does not respect certain mathematic properties like associativity and distributivity, so building using different compilers, or even the same compiler with different flags, can lead to different re-ordering of instructions and thus different result, even on a strictly comformant ieee754 implementation. It's also possible that the software implementation used on SPARC is buggy, I don't know.

Getting portable and reproducible results with floating-point code is very difficult and it appears this particular program fails quite miserably at it; perhaps it doesn't even try to. Avoiding x87 is a step in the right direction, but not a guarantee in itself of consistent results.

    • Windows 11 KB5094126 BSODing, freezing, forcing BitLocker lockout, breaks OneDrive, and more by Sayan Sen Microsoft released Windows 11 KB5094126 and KB5093998 last week as the latest Patch Tuesday updates. Following that the company also published the accompanying dynamic updates under KB5094149, KB5095971, and KB5094156. While Microsoft has so far not acknowledged any major problems with the release, some users online are running into problems. These range from OneDrive and Dropbox access issues, BitLocker recovery lockouts, to blue screens and BSODs. The most common one seems to be happening with HP systems wherein affected users say they hit 0xc0430001 BSOD (blue screen of death) error code after the KB5094126 update. We wonder if this could be related to the recent bug we covered on HP devices wherein the ongoing Secure Boot certificate updates are leading to similar issues. While we are not certain, users affected by this issue likely need to ensure that the boot.stl file is included on the installation media (such as a USB installer or ISO), if the above-mentioned dynamic updates are deployed. If this file is missing, computers may fail to boot from the installation media and could display the error 0xc0430001. This STL file is used by Secure Boot to verify that the boot files are trusted, so it must match the same Windows version and system architecture. To ensure the file is included, Microsoft recommends using the Update WinPE script, which automatically updates the image and handles the required files. Alternatively, you can manually copy the boot.stl file from the Windows\Boot\EFI folder on a Windows device and place it in the matching folder on your installation media before deploying the updated image. Aside from blue screening some users also note their systems have been freezing following the update. This could be happening to Lenovo PCs specifically. In the case of the OneDrive and Dropbox access issues, a user figured out that there could be a conflict with UAC. He explained: "Okay, so I did some digging, and in our environment KB5094126 breaks OneDrive and Dropbox in Explorer. I went through all our GPOs and found out that the combination of disabling UAC and having my user being a local admin breaks OneDrive in Explorer. ... If I enable UAC again, then it works, even with KB5094126 still installed." Hopefully, Microsoft will look into these issues.
